Biography

Ingo Ziegler is a PhD fellow at the University of Copenhagen, specializing in Natural Language Processing. His research focuses on advancing techniques in tokenization-free language modeling and representation learning to obtain meaningful text representations. Ingo also explores generative modeling and synthetic data generation to enhance the capabilities of machine learning systems. With a commitment to collaboration, he engages in projects that analyze and extract insights from data, contributing to publications and research networks in the field of linguistics and machine learning. His academic contributions position him at the forefront of innovative approaches to language processing.
